The production of KP-95 corundum files [1, 2] involves certain laborious and energy-consuming processes in obtaining kaolinized corundum chamotte, including dry pressing the finely milled mixture of alumina and kaolin, replacing the briquet on kil cars, drying it, and firing in a tunnel kiln at 1520-1580~The Semiluksk factory has developed and implemented a method for the production of high-grade tiles for gate valves, which involves replacing the kaolinized corundum chamotte by a more economical material. It is best to use m~lite--corundum chamotte obtained at the Semiluksk factory, using the normal methods.The water absorption of the mullite--eorundum ehamotte is not more than 2%, * A1203 content not less than 85%, Fe203 not more than 0.5%, and SiO 2 9-10%. The main requirement in changing from kaolinized corundum ehamotte (not less than 95% A1203, not more than 0.5% Fe203 and 1.8-2% SiO2) to a material with a lower refractoriness was the preservation, together with the high density, of adequately high-temperature strength and corrosion resistance, which ensure the stable operation of the tiles.It is known that the high-temperature strength and also the resistance to the action of molten slags and metal by aluminosilicate refractories of a granular structure depend on the composition and structure of the * Here and subsequently parts by weight.
